  • Abstract
    A new design of dual-mode bandstop filters with four poles employed by single dual-mode microstrip square loop resonators are proposed. Two fourth order filters with two pairs of reflection zeros at real or imaginary finite frequencies are demonstrated with simulations and measurements. It is shown that the location of reflection zeros and degenerated modes can be easily controlled by simply changing the perturbation element size. It is shown that one of fourth order filters has two finite-frequency reflection zeros on only left side of the stopband, while the other one has two pairs of finite-frequency reflection zeros in the lower and upper passbands. Good agreement between simulated and measured results is achieved.
